Vessel sealing devices work by utilizing electrical energy to fuse tissue together while simultaneously coagulating blood vessels, thus minimizing the risks of bleeding during surgery. With various types available—including laparoscopic and open surgery devices—buyers must assess their specific needs based on the surgical applications they intend to support.

When it comes to purchasing vessel sealing devices, there are several key considerations buyers should keep in mind. Firstly, understanding the technical specifications of the devices is essential. It is vital to review the device's sealing capacity, the types of tissues it can handle, and its operational temperatures. Additionally, it’s essential to evaluate the compatibility of these devices with existing surgical equipment to ensure seamless integration into clinical practice.

Another essential factor is the regulatory compliance of the devices. Buyers should ensure that the products meet relevant standards and certifications, such as those from the U.S. Food and Drug Administration (FDA) or the Conformité Européenne (CE) mark in Europe. Compliance with these regulations not only guarantees that devices are safe and effective but also reassures buyers when making their purchasing decisions.

Cost is also a crucial element. Vessel sealing devices can vary significantly in price based on brand, features, and performance. While it may be tempting to opt for the lowest-cost options, it's important to consider the long-term value, including durability and effectiveness. Investing in high-quality devices can lead to better patient outcomes and a reduction in overall healthcare costs due to fewer complications and reoperations.
